Ubud, Bali
Rumah Cinta, meaning the House Made of Love, is a large open-air home atop a ridge in Penestanan, at the edge of Ubud, close to the Camphuan Hotel. From the third story tower, you can see the sunrise, the sunset, volcanoes to the north, and the sea to the south. The rooms are large and airy, with large windows and doors that slide back to let the breezes through.
The first floor great room is large and beautifully furnished, with a living area and a reading nook with a view of the gardens and pool, and a Balinese-style kitchen: refrigerator, two-propane burners, but NO OVEN. The house is equipped with some cooking utensils and dishes, though the Balinese are such good cooks, you should rarely cook for yourself!!
The two downstairs bathrooms -- one off the great room and one off the downstairs bedroom -- are in lovely walled gardens with statuary and tropical plants.
The second-floor primary queen bedroom, which faces west for beautiful evening skies, has 2 decks with large sliding doors, an open-air bathroom, and a stairway to the tower and rooftop viewing area. Also upstairs is a second queen bedroom with an indoor half-bath.
Artistic touches are everywhere you look, both in the house and out. There are paintings by local artists, Indonesian carvings, carved wood and stone around windows and doors, high thatched ceilings and beautiful rock and tile work, all hand done.
This home is designed to be one with the outdoors, so even more beauty awaits you outside, where the gardens are dense but well tended, two temples protect the property, and the infinity-edge swimming pool offers a cool, calm retreat both daytime and at night. There are a toilet and a shower by the pool, in addition to the 4 bathrooms inside the house.
IMPORTANT -- PLEASE NOTE:
1) This home sits on a walking path high on a ridge -- its closest access from the main road is a flight of about 100 stairsteps. There are 3 other ways to get to the house, which involve many fewer stairsteps but longer paths from the road -- perhaps a 10-minute walk.
2) The house is designed to take advantage of the outdoors. It is outfitted with thick walls and breezy with ceiling fans, but it is not air-conditioned. And because I don't spray poisons on my land, you may have some geckos or other harmless critters pass through occasionally. .Please DO NOT RENT THIS HOUSE if any of these things will make you unhappy or uncomfortable.
